Things to do in Logan?
Logan, OH is a small town located in the southeastern region of the state. With a population of just over 5,000 people, Logan offers a tight-knit community and atmosphere. Residents enjoy its wide array of outdoor activities including fishing and hiking at nearby parks, as well as participating in local events such as the annual Hog Roast or 2nd Saturday events. The downtown area is thriving with small businesses, restaurants, and shops that cater to both locals and visitors alike. While there are no major attractions close by, the quaintness of Logan living makes it a great place to settle down and call home.
